What are the common themes in arranged marriage real life stories?
1 answer
2024-11-21 22:54
In arranged marriage real life stories, there is often the theme of unexpected compatibility. Couples may seem very different at first but later find that they share important values. For instance, a couple might have different career paths but both value honesty and loyalty highly. Another common theme is the role of time. It takes time for the relationship to develop, and through shared experiences over time, they build a strong connection. This could include things like taking care of family members together or building a new home.
